On Wednesday 16 May 2007 4:22 am, Zdenek Pavlas wrote: > Hello everybody, > > Because of Windows' draconic handling of page faults 'sub esp, 4096' is > a no-no. Rare functions needing page or more of stack space must call > chkstk(stacksize) first. TCC needs 10 bytes for such call while the > standard function prolog was only 9 so it pads them to 10 bytes. > > This patch uses a shorter chkstk() calling convention that fits in 9 > bytes so no more padding.
